    About the Company Our client has been a trusted tyre specialist in Northland for over 30 years, known for their commitment to delivering 100% service—anywhere, anytime. We are currently seeking a skilled Tyre Technician to join their team, where you will be engaged in both retail and commercial fleet services. About the Role As a Tyre Technician, you will play a crucial role in supporting our customers with a comprehensive range of tyre services, catering to various vehicles from passenger cars to heavy-duty trucks. Your key responsibilities will include: - Fitting, repairing, and balancing tyres for passenger vehicles, motorcycles, trucks, tractors, and OTR vehicles. - Performing wheel alignments on customer vehicles. - Completing puncture repairs and tube fitments to the highest standards. - Attending fleet service callouts, which may occasionally require after-hours and weekend work. - Providing exceptional customer service to ensure that customer needs are consistently met. - Participating in ongoing training and supporting the wider team as needed. Requirements To excel in this role, you will need: - A minimum of three years of relevant work experience. - Strong technical skills in tyre fitting, repairs, balancing, and alignments. - A positive attitude and a dedication to delivering excellent customer service. - Flexibility to work afterhours or weekends for fleet service callouts. - A full driver's license. - The ability to pass a pre-employment drug and alcohol test. - A clean police record with no pending charges.
